Problem

Conventional corner boards for container stacks require additional materials like staples or tape for attachment, which are time-consuming, costly, and pose safety risks, and can damage containers or their contents during handling and transportation.

Innovation Solution

A corner board design featuring a slit and notch near one end, allowing it to be easily placed on container stacks without additional attachment materials, using a manufacturing method that bends and cuts board stock to form angled sides with a slit and notch, enabling secure stacking without staples or tape.

AI summary

A corner board includes first and second sides, each including a board material; a bend between the first and second sides, joining first and second sides together; and a slit adjacent to a first end of the corner board, the slit completely crossing the bend and partially crossing the first and second sides. In addition, a method of manufacturing a corner board includes bending a board stock to form first and second sides of the corner board with an angle therebetween; cutting the board stock into fixed lengths, the bent and cut board stock forming the corner board; and forming a slit near a first end of the corner board. The present corner board may be advantageously rested or placed along a vertical edge of a container or stack of containers.
